--- MITgcm/verification/bottom_ctrl_5x5/code_ad/ad_optfile.local 2013/08/07 16:23:32 1.3 +++ MITgcm/verification/bottom_ctrl_5x5/code_ad/ad_optfile.local 2016/01/15 18:37:45 1.4 @@ -1,6 +1,6 @@ #!/bin/bash # -# $Header: /home/ubuntu/mnt/e9_copy/MITgcm/verification/bottom_ctrl_5x5/code_ad/ad_optfile.local,v 1.3 2013/08/07 16:23:32 heimbach Exp $ +# $Header: /home/ubuntu/mnt/e9_copy/MITgcm/verification/bottom_ctrl_5x5/code_ad/ad_optfile.local,v 1.4 2016/01/15 18:37:45 jmc Exp $ # $Name: $ # This AD option-file contains the settings for the adjoint and @@ -17,12 +17,24 @@ TAMC=tamc AD_TAMC_FLAGS="-reverse -i4 -r4 -l tamc_ad.log $AD_TAMC_FLAGS" -AD_TAF_FLAGS="-e -reverse -i4 -r4 -l taf_ad.log $AD_TAF_FLAGS" FTL_TAMC_FLAGS="-forward -i4 -r4 -l tamc_ftl.log $FTL_TAMC_FLAGS" -FTL_TAF_FLAGS="-e -forward -i4 -r4 -l taf_ftl.log $FTL_TAF_FLAGS" SVD_TAMC_FLAGS="-reverse -forward -pure -i4 -r4 -l tamc_svd.log $SVD_TAMC_FLAGS" + +AD_TAF_FLAGS="-e -reverse -i4 -r4 -l taf_ad.log $AD_TAF_FLAGS" +FTL_TAF_FLAGS="-e -forward -i4 -r4 -l taf_ftl.log $FTL_TAF_FLAGS" SVD_TAF_FLAGS="-reverse -forward -pure -i4 -r4 -l taf_svd.log $SVD_TAF_FLAGS" +#- after Jan 14, 2016, TAF default is "-f95" +if test "x$ALWAYS_USE_F90" = "x1" ; then + AD_TAF_FLAGS="-f90 $AD_TAF_FLAGS" + FTL_TAF_FLAGS="-f90 $FTL_TAF_FLAGS" + SVD_TAF_FLAGS="-f90 $SVD_TAF_FLAGS" +else + AD_TAF_FLAGS="-f77 $AD_TAF_FLAGS" + FTL_TAF_FLAGS="-f77 $FTL_TAF_FLAGS" + SVD_TAF_FLAGS="-f77 $SVD_TAF_FLAGS" +fi + DIFF_FLAGS="-toplevel 'the_main_loop' \ -input 'xx_theta_dummy \ xx_salt_dummy \